  12. I'm no pro, but thought I'd offer a small bit of advice. When you're learning the game and playing online, DO NOT OVER-FOCUS ON WINNING. I did this with CT and it held me back so hard. Placing too much importance on winning, in my experience, leads to panicking when you inevitably start to get owned, which leads to mashing without thinking about what you're doing, which leads to sucking and bad habits. Try to think of online mode as a learning experience, and save your replays, even when you lose, so you can figure out what you were doing and what you could do better.
